Comprehending Window Weatherproofing
Window weatherproofing includes strategies and materials that seal windows against the components. By efficiently handling air leakages and water penetration, property owners can maintain a comfortable indoor environment while reducing energy expenses.
Advantages of Weatherproofing Windows
Weatherproofing offers various benefits for homes and their occupants:
Energy Efficiency: Reducing drafts and heat loss can lead to substantial cost savings on energy costs.Comfort: Improved insulation results in a more consistent indoor temperature level.Protection from Moisture: Weatherproofing assists avoid water damage, mold growth, and wear and tear of Window Renovation frames and surrounding structures.Enhanced Durability: By keeping moisture and drafts at bay, weatherproofing can extend the life-span of windows and their frames.Noise Reduction: Proper sealing can also help reduce outside sound, developing a quieter home environment.Common Methods of Window Weatherproofing
There are numerous approaches offered for weatherproofing windows, each with distinct materials and strategies. Property owners can select to execute one or more of these approaches depending on their particular needs:
Caulking: A flexible sealing substance used to spaces and fractures around window frames to produce a tight seal.Weatherstripping: A material positioned around the edges of window sashes to obstruct air leaks. Common types include adhesive-backed foam, V-strip, and tubular rubber.Storm Windows: Additional windows installed either inside or outside existing windows to offer an additional layer of insulation and protection from the aspects.Window Handyman Film: A thin plastic movie applied to the interior glass to lower heat loss and guard versus UV rays.Insulated Curtains: Heavy drapes designed to trap air and keep cold or hot air from penetrating.Foam Sealant: Expanding foam used to fill bigger gaps and cracks around window frames for a more comprehensive seal.Step-by-Step Guide to Weatherproofing Windows
Homeowners can follow this step-by-step guide to efficiently weatherproof their windows:
Materials NeededCaulk and caulking weaponWeatherstrippingUtility knifeDetermining tapeScissorsSponge (for cleaning)Window film (optional)Insulated curtains (optional)Weatherproofing Process
Examine Windows: Examine windows for spaces and cracks. Look for signs of moisture damage, rot, or mold.

Clean: Clean the surface area around the window frame with a sponge and let it dry completely. This makes sure appropriate adhesion of caulk and weatherstripping.

Apply Caulk:
Load the caulk into the caulking weapon.Cut the nozzle at a 45-degree angle and puncture the inner seal.Apply caulk in a constant, even line along the gaps and joints around the window frame.
Install Weatherstripping:
Measure the sides of the window sash and cut the weatherstripping to size.Remove the support and press the weatherstripping firmly against the window frame.
Think About Storm Windows or Film: If extra defense is wanted, set up storm windows or apply Window Renovation movie according to the producer's guidelines.

Final Touches: Hang insulated drapes to enhance thermal performance and minimize energy costs further.
Maintenance of Weatherproofed Windows
To make sure the effectiveness of weatherproofing efforts, regular maintenance is necessary. Homeowners ought to examine windows at least as soon as a year, looking for:
Cracked or deteriorating caulkWear and tear on weatherstrippingSigns of wetness infiltrationTips for Maintaining WeatherproofingReapply caulk in locations where it has actually split or shrunk.Change used or damaged weatherstripping promptly.Clean window frames and glass to prevent buildup of particles and wetness.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How can I tell if my windows require weatherproofing?A1: Signs include visible drafts, condensation on windows, peeling paint or damage around frames, and greater energy bills. Q2: Can I weatherproof my windows myself?A2: Yes, lots of weatherproofing jobs can be carried out by homeowners with basic tools and materials. Nevertheless, for comprehensive repair work or installation of storm windows, hiring a professional may be wise. Q3: How frequently should I weatherproof my windows?A3: Routine evaluations need to be conducted annually, with weatherproofingproducts replaced as required. Q4: Do storm windows make a significant difference in energy efficiency?A4: Yes, storm windows can supply an additional layer of insulation that significantly lowers energy loss. Q5: Is there an affordable method to weatherproof my windows?A5: Applying caulk and weatherstripping are relatively affordable and efficient methods for improving window insulation.
